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45046592871 49373614 99802603337 780160163
86705 6408530 7640335
86705 6408530 7640335
89220105438 05207861 2179
All about undefined
Interested in learning more?
86705 6408530 7640335
89220105438 05207861 2179
See more
7405731200 36
8945 7354847311 918140
See more
823189 045286 5735
8943 0514136 64432623
See more